Recently I've been going back and forth trying to make a decision about this myself. I had a Turkey Hunting USA cabinet I picked up last fall in a cab lot that's been gathering dust. Cab was in great physical condition with a nice 27' monitor but had no guns and the flyback needed replaced on the monitor. Initially I planned on repairing the monitor (or replacing it with a 27' CRT TV) and putting in a Playstation-to-JAMMA PCB. Combine that with a PS2 with hard drive and some third party guns that are Guncon/Justifier compatible and I could play the entire PS1 and PS2 library without changing guns or consoles. Be able to play a few PS2 Atomiswave ports is icing on the cake.
In the end though I ended up doing the complete opposite, grabbed some Amtrak guns, yanked the out CRT for a 24' LCD monitor, used a CGA-to-VGA converter board so I could hook the PS2 up, and I also added a PC for emulators.
The main reasons I decided on LCD + Aimtrak over a CRT with Guncon/Justifier was software. With the exception of the Time Crisis: Project Titan every PS1 gun game I really liked was an arcade port (all of which are superior in MAME) plus there's quite a few arcade emulator exclusive games. I definitely prefer the Guncon's preciseness and ease of use but the amount of additional games supported by the Aimtrak coupled with a cheap PC make up for the inconvenience.
